Elkhart bus driver fired after impairment accusations

An Elkhart school bus driver accused of being impaired while working has been fired.
The issue came up in January after someone filed a complaint. The district placed the driver on unpaid leave, and state police began investigating.
The driver, Lisa Wig, has faced similar accusations before. In 2021, she worked briefly as a bus monitor for Concord schools and was let go about a month later after being reported for smelling like alcohol at work.
School records say she broke rules that ban employees from using or having alcohol or drugs while on the job or on school property.
She’s also accused of working while under the influence. State police are still wrapping up their investigation and plan to send their findings to the county prosecutor.
